hey guys
ok so i got this icd pro-master and i have taken it apart to find that its leaking from this crack.
no idea how it happened but i need a new "regulator mount" and preferably the rest of the section in the pictures
not sure on price...
anyone who knows of somewhere i can acquire this online would also be greatly apreceated
thanks for looking
ok so i got this icd pro-master and i have taken it apart to find that its leaking from this crack.
no idea how it happened but i need a new "regulator mount" and preferably the rest of the section in the pictures
not sure on price...
anyone who knows of somewhere i can acquire this online would also be greatly apreceated
thanks for looking
Attachments
-
2.5 MB Views: 9
-
2 MB Views: 9
-
1.5 MB Views: 9
-
1.4 MB Views: 8
-
1.5 MB Views: 6